Job description

Commercial Property Solicitor

Hybrid - Bedford

£(phone number removed) plus substantial pension contributions

Reporting to the Supervising Partner, the successful candidate will be able to demonstrate a solid background in commercial property. This will include acquisitions and disposals, creating and renewing business leases on behalf of both landlords and tenants, lease extensions, right to buy, right to acquire and experience in both agricultural land and development would be useful.

Candidate Specification

  1. A minimum of 2 years PQE in the relevant area of law.
  2. Good client care skills, provide professional and competent legal advice in accordance with SRA Code of conduct.
  3. Strong IT skills.
  4. Effective business development skills with proven marketing strategies.
  5. Capability to generate fees in accordance with agreed targets.
  6. Up-to-date knowledge and skills in compliance with Continuing Professional Development and internal training expectations.
  7. Proven experience of handling own caseload.
  8. Ability to adhere to and manage deadlines.
  9. Good drafting and writing skills, excellent communication and technical ability.
